| require File.expand_path('../../test_helper', __FILE__)
 | |
| require 'capybara/rails'
 | |
| 
 | |
| Capybara.default_driver = :selenium
 | |
| Capybara.register_driver :selenium do |app|
 | |
|   # Use the following driver definition to test locally using Chrome (also requires chromedriver to be in PATH)
 | |
|   # Capybara::Selenium::Driver.new(app, :browser => :chrome)
 | |
|   # Add :switches => %w[--lang=en] to force default browser locale to English
 | |
|   # Default for Selenium remote driver is to connect to local host on port 4444 
 | |
|   # This can be change using :url => 'http://localhost:9195' if necessary
 | |
|   # PhantomJS 1.8 now directly supports Webdriver Wire API, simply run it with `phantomjs --webdriver 4444`
 | |
|   # Add :desired_capabilities => Selenium::WebDriver::Remote::Capabilities.internet_explorer) to run on Selenium Grid Hub with IE
 | |
|   Capybara::Selenium::Driver.new(app, :browser => :remote)
 | |
| end
 | |
| 
 | |
| module Redmine
 | |
|   module UiTest
 | |
|     # Base class for UI tests
 | |
|     class Base < ActionDispatch::IntegrationTest
 | |
|       include Capybara::DSL
 | |
| 
 | |
|       # Stop ActiveRecord from wrapping tests in transactions
 | |
|       # Transactional fixtures do not work with Selenium tests, because Capybara
 | |
|       # uses a separate server thread, which the transactions would be hidden
 | |
|       self.use_transactional_fixtures = false
 | |
| 
 | |
|       # Should not depend on locale since Redmine displays login page
 | |
|       # using default browser locale which depend on system locale for "real" browsers drivers
 | |
|       def log_user(login, password)
 | |
|         visit '/my/page'
 | |
|         assert_equal '/login', current_path
 | |
|         within('#login-form form') do
 | |
|           fill_in 'username', :with => login
 | |
|           fill_in 'password', :with => password
 | |
|           find('input[name=login]').click
 | |
|         end
 | |
|         assert_equal '/my/page', current_path
 | |
|       end
 | |
| 
 | |
|       teardown do
 | |
|         Capybara.reset_sessions!    # Forget the (simulated) browser state
 | |
|         Capybara.use_default_driver # Revert Capybara.current_driver to Capybara.default_driver
 | |
|       end
 | |
|     end
 | |
|   end
 | |
| end
